A long-standing issue is that SA (and DMR) excludes horses in the TrackMaster data file that are EARLY scratches, unlike every other track on the continent, which simply show EARLY scratches as part of the runner list.

So if the #2 horse (for example) is scratched, the TrackMaster data will not even include it, and RDSS will show horses 1,3,4,5,6 ...

Then, when RDSS contacts the TwinSpires tote system and finds that the #2 horse is scratched (correctly, in this example), it marks the 2nd horse it knows about as scratched - which in this example would be the #3 horse (incorrectly).

I suspect something like that happened to you :(

The solution is to check the actual scratches according to your ADW (particularly in the case of SoCal: SA and DMR).

If RDSS persists in scratching your horse in this case, you'll have to turn off the tote system (http://www.paceandcap.com/forums/sho...&postcount=251).
